- Ark's Newsletter
- Posts
- How to Start a Blog in 2025 and Make $10,000/Month
How to Start a Blog in 2025 and Make $10,000/Month
Your Ultimate Step-by-Step Guide to Blogging Success

Blogging is more alive than ever in 2025! In fact, it’s one of the most profitable and accessible ways to make money online today. Whether you want to share your passion, build a personal brand, or create a passive income stream, starting a blog is the perfect platform to achieve these goals. The best part? You don’t need to be a tech wizard or a professional writer to succeed.
In this guide, I’ll show you step-by-step how to start a blog in 2025 that can make $10,000 or more per month. From choosing your niche to monetizing your content, this guide covers it all. Let’s get started!
Step 1: Choose Your Niche (The Foundation of Your Success)
Your niche is the cornerstone of your blog. It’s what your blog will be about and who it will serve. To pick a profitable niche in 2025, consider these three key factors:
Passion and Expertise: Choose a topic you’re passionate about or knowledgeable in. Blogging requires consistency, so you’ll need a topic that keeps you inspired.
Demand: Make sure people are searching for information in your niche. Use tools like Google Trends or Ubersuggest to check search volume.
Profitability: Look for niches with monetization opportunities, such as affiliate marketing, sponsored posts, or selling digital products.
Some hot blogging niches in 2025 include personal finance, health and wellness, tech reviews, sustainable living, and online side hustles.
Step 2: Set Up Your Blog (The Easy Way)
You don’t need coding skills to set up a blog in 2025. With platforms like 10Web, you can create a stunning blog in minutes. Here’s how:
Get a Domain Name and Hosting: A domain name is your blog’s address (e.g., http://www.yourblogname.com). Hosting is where your blog lives online. 10Web offers an all-in-one solution, including domain registration and hosting, optimized for speed and security.
Install WordPress: WordPress is the most popular blogging platform in the world. With 10Web’s AI-powered platform, you can install WordPress with a single click.
Choose a Theme: Your theme determines how your blog looks. Pick a mobile-friendly, fast-loading theme from 10Web’s theme library to make a great first impression.
Step 3: Create High-Quality Content (The Key to Growing Your Audience)
Content is king, and in 2025, quality matters more than ever. Focus on creating helpful, engaging, and original content that solves your audience’s problems. Here’s how:
Write Long-Form Posts: Aim for at least 1,500 words per post to cover topics in depth. Use headings, bullet points, and visuals to make your content easy to read.
Use SEO: Optimize your posts for search engines by including keywords, meta descriptions, and alt text for images. Tools like Yoast SEO or RankMath can help.
Post Consistently: Develop a content calendar and stick to it. Consistency builds trust and keeps your audience coming back.
Step 4: Monetize Your Blog (How to Earn $10,000/Month)
Once you’ve built an audience, it’s time to monetize. Here are the most effective ways to make money blogging in 2025:
Affiliate Marketing: Promote products or services you love and earn a commission for each sale. For example, you can recommend 10Web’s AI-powered website builder, Pictory’s video creation tools, and Beehiiv’s email marketing platform to maximize your affiliate income.
Sponsored Posts: Collaborate with brands to create content that features their products. Sponsored posts can pay anywhere from $500 to $5,000+ per post, depending on your audience size.
Digital Products: Sell eBooks, courses, or printables related to your niche. These have high profit margins and are scalable.
Display Ads: Join ad networks like Google AdSense or Mediavine to earn passive income through ads on your blog.
Coaching or Consulting: Offer one-on-one services in your niche to leverage your expertise.
Step 5: Promote Your Blog (Get Traffic and Grow!)
Traffic is the lifeblood of your blog. Use these strategies to drive visitors to your site:
Social Media: Share your posts on platforms like Instagram, Pinterest, and LinkedIn to reach your target audience.
Email Marketing: Build an email list and send regular newsletters with updates and exclusive content. Use platforms like Beehive to grow your email subscribers efficiently.
Networking: Collaborate with other bloggers and participate in guest posting to expand your reach.
Paid Ads: Use Google Ads or Facebook Ads to promote your blog posts to a broader audience.
Conclusion: Start Your Blogging Journey Today
Starting a blog in 2025 is easier and more rewarding than ever. With platforms like 10Web, Pictory, and Beehive, you can launch your blog quickly and focus on what matters most: creating amazing content and growing your audience.
So, what are you waiting for? Click here to get started with 10Web today. Your $10,000/month blogging journey begins now!

Looking for the perfect gifts or a little something special for yourself this season? Discover amazing products that will make your holidays unforgettable! Click here to explore now!
Affiliate Disclaimer:This article may contain affiliate links, which means I may earn a small commission at no additional cost to you if you click through and make a purchase. As an affiliate, I only recommend products and services that I genuinely believe will add value to your holiday season. Your support helps me continue to create helpful content—thank you!